People ask also, what is unit format in AutoCAD? AutoCAD‘s length unit types are as follows: Architectural units are based in feet and inches and use fractions to represent partial inches: for example, 12′3 1/2″. The base unit is the inch unless otherwise specified, so if you enter a number like 147.5, then AutoCAD will understand it to be 12′3 1/2″.

What is AutoCAD limit?

The Limits command in AutoCAD is used to set an invisible rectangular boundary in the drawing area or viewport. It limits the grid display and the point locations. We are required to specify the coordinates of the opposite corners of the rectangular window.

How do I set AutoCAD to CM?

  1. Click Drafting tab > Modify panel > Scale.
  2. At the Select Objects prompt, enter all.
  3. Enter a base point of *0,0. Scaling will be relative to the world coordinate system (WCS) origin and the location of the drawing origin will remain at the WCS origin.
  4. Enter a scale factor.
